James Knight

James Knight is a Consultant for Bonhams Classic Cars department.

Formerly Bonhams' Executive Director and Group Motoring Chairman, as well as one of the longest serving specialists in the industry, James has handled record-breaking auctions of both collections and individual motor cars. Some of the major collections he has offered include Rosso Bianco; Maranello Rosso; The Autocar Archives on behalf of Haymarket Publishing Group; and British Motor Industry Heritage Trust dispersal sale. Among the exceptional motor cars he has brought to auction, there is the world's oldest Rolls-Royce; the ex-works 1953-55 Austin-Healey Special Test Car/100S; and Jaguar C- and D-Types, and the unique Jaguar prototype E2A. Each of these motor cars achieved world auction record prices.

James also acts as an adviser to a number of institutions, which include manufacturers, trusts and museums. He is also an accomplished auctioneer and nominated 'Auctioneer of the Year' for the British Antiques and Collectors Association. He owns a 1954 Austin-Healey 100.
